CVE-2023-2512 is an integer overflow vulnerability in the FormData API implementation of Cloudflare workerd, affecting versions prior to v1.20230419.0. This flaw could lead to a segmentation fault or arbitrary undefined behavior when processing FormData instances with an extremely large number of elements. Rated 8.1 HIGH (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H), exploitation is highly complex, requiring massive memory allocation (160GB RAM) and multi-gigabyte HTTP requests.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ion, and it is not listed in CISA's KEV catalog.
